Oddaljen nadzor temperature in vlažnostiSTARIČ, ALEŠ (Avtor)
Burnik, Urban (Mentor)
merjenje temperaturemerjenje relativne vlageoddaljen nadzorinternet stvariArduinoRESTJSONjQuerryCilj diplomskega dela je izdelava mrežnega merilnika temperature in vlage, ki nam ponuja vpogled v omenjeni veličini na neki oddaljeni lokaciji. Želeli smo, da je prikaz mogoč z različnimi napravami, zato smo uporabili moderne prosto dostopne odprtokodne programske rešitve, ki ponujajo te storitve. Implementirali smo sistem, ki s preprostimi metodami preko mikrokrmilnika z omogočenim mrežnim dostopom pošilja podatke na spletno stran, kjer so obdelani in prikazani v preteklem in realnem času.
V uvodnem poglavju smo se spoznali z različnimi vrstami naprav za nadzor temperature in vlažnosti, ki zbirajo podatke za upravljanje s klimatskimi pogoji v prostorih. Ugotovili smo, da tržišče nudi široko izbiro sistemov, ki so prilagojeni različnim vrstam uporabe. Poleg preprostih sistemov smo omenili tudi tehnološko naprednejše, ki podpirajo mrežno komunikacijo in uporabniku s pomočjo internetnih protokolov omogočajo vpogled in nadzor preko oddaljene lokacije. Na koncu poglavja smo navedli še nekaj pomembnih značilnosti interneta stvari ter različne načine implementacije ethernet podsistemov.
V osrednjem poglavju so predstavljene strojne in programske rešitve za realizacijo našega sistema. Opisali smo odprtokodni standard za prenos podatkov JSON ter omejitve in storitve, ki nam jih ponuja arhitekturni stil REST. Dodan je še opis rešitve za prikaz in delovanje sistema na mobilnih napravah.
Na koncu sledi še podroben opis poteka implementacije programske opreme. Predstavljeni in razčlenjeni so segmenti programske kode, ki skrbijo za logiko, prenos in prikaz podatkov. Priloženi so sheme in diagrami, ki grafično ponazorijo način delovanja sistema.20162016-06-08 15:45:01Diplomsko delo/naloga83230VisID: 34689sl